The cheapest way to get from Redfern to Kangaroo Valley is to bus and line 810 bus which costs $15 - $25 and takes 3h 43m.
The fastest way to get from Redfern to Kangaroo Valley is to drive which takes 1h 52m and costs $26 - $40.
No, there is no direct bus from Redfern station to Kangaroo Valley. However, there are services departing from Central Station, Forecourt, Coach Bay 1 and arriving at Church Of The Good Sheperd, Moss Vale Rd via Leighton Gardens, Argyle St.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 43m.
The distance between Redfern and Kangaroo Valley is 171 km. The road distance is 148.6 km.
The best way to get from Redfern to Kangaroo Valley without a car is to train and line 810 bus which takes 3h 25m and costs $12 - $150.
It takes approximately 3h 25m to get from Redfern to Kangaroo Valley, including transfers.
Redfern to Kangaroo Valley bus services, operated by NSW TrainLink, depart from Central Station, Forecourt, Coach Bay 1.
The best way to get from Redfern to Kangaroo Valley is to bus and line 810 bus which takes 3h 43m and costs $15 - $25. Alternatively, you can train, which costs $18 - $26 and takes 4h 39m.
Redfern to Kangaroo Valley bus services, operated by NSW TrainLink, arrive at Leighton Gardens, Argyle St station.
Yes, the driving distance between Redfern to Kangaroo Valley is 149 km. It takes approximately 1h 52m to drive from Redfern to Kangaroo Valley.
